| 1:01.4 | Hello and welcome to technology today. I'm Lisa Pena. |
| 1:04.1 | We are launching 2026 with a discussion on science principles in pop culture. |
| 1:10.5 | Our guest today says superheroes and |
| 1:12.8 | anime plots stir imagination and curiosity while tapping into complex science, technology, engineering, |
| 1:20.3 | and math, or STEM concepts. SWRI, astrophysicist Dr. Roman Gomez, presents at anime conventions, teaches a college course on the topic, |
| 1:30.3 | and recently was the lead author of a research article published in the Frontiers in Education Journal, |
| 1:36.8 | titled The Power of Anime, using anime for education and outreach in STEM. |
| 1:42.9 | He joins us now to tell us about this fun and effective approach to teaching physics and much more. |
